BS83B08 ile çalışan var mı?

Başlatan merve damar, 20 Ağustos 2019, 16:58:06

merve damar

Merhaba iyi çalışmalar. Holteğin BS83B08 dokunmatik işlemcisi hakkında bir çalışma yaptınız mı acaba? Kaynak ve örnek kod bulamıyorum. Bir öneriniz var mı ?

merve damar

ht-Ide 3000 kullanmak istiyoruz. Açıkçası datasheetten, amaçladığımız adreslemeyi nasıl yapacağımızı bilmiyoruz. Bu sebeple daha kolay anlaşılır kodlar bulmak istiyoruz. Yani register olarak.

~ENES~

Bs83b08 islemcisini nereden tedarik ediyorsunuz ? Bende kullanmak istiyorum :) Datasheette adresleme haritasi verilmiş oradan yola cikarak yapilabilir. Spi calisiyor sanirim.

merve damar


RaMu

Şunu arıyorum sorularına bunu kullan cevabı vermeyi sevmiyorum ama
örneği olan yaygın kullanılan işi kolaylaştıracak bir seçim yapmak gerekirdi.

Pic16F1827 vs. gibi birçok seçenek var.
Sorularınıza hızlı cevap alın: http://www.picproje.org/index.php/topic,57135.0.html

Epsilon

Aradığınız malzeme bu firmada var
http://www.semtech.com.tr/product/holtek-semiconductor-inc

Firma Holtek in Türkiye distribütörü malzemenin fiyatı 40 cent

BS83B08 A-3 (16 N SOP)

merve damar

Alıntı yapılan: RaMu - 21 Ağustos 2019, 14:20:14Şunu arıyorum sorularına bunu kullan cevabı vermeyi sevmiyorum ama
örneği olan yaygın kullanılan işi kolaylaştıracak bir seçim yapmak gerekirdi.

Pic16F1827 vs. gibi birçok seçenek var.
Evet. Doğru söylüyorsunuz. O  seçeneği, foruma bu soruyu sormadan önce düşünmüştük. Fakat bu soruyu soruyorsam bunu kullanmak zorunda olduğum için soruyorumdur. Sonuçta herkes daha yaygın bir işlemci kullanmak ister.

Epsilon

#7
(silinebilir)

RaMu

Zorunluluk varsa ayrı mesele,
tabi yardım isterken bunun nedenlerinide olabildiğince açıklamak lazım,
çok az kişinin işine yarayacak bir konuda
emek verip yardım etmek isteyen doğal olarak pek çıkmaz.

Forum olarak araştırmacı ve meraklı olduğumuz için
şöyle bir yöntemle yardım edebiliriz,
ben ve birçok arkadaşımız datasheet okuyup register seviyesinde ve hatta asm kod yazan kişileriz,
datasheetten parça parça ilgili yerleri paylaşıp
bu nasıl oluyor nasıl yaparız diye sorabilirsin
anladığımız kadarıyla yardımcı oluruz.

Üstünkörü baktım sitesinde bazı kod örnekleri var (asm)
arayıp en alakalı olanı bulmak lazım

https://www.holtek.com/documents/10179/2629206/C60001-A2_B2.zip

Yukarıdaki link alttaki aramadaki
C60001-A2_B2.zip adlı klasör
https://www.holtek.com/search?key=bs83b08

O klasörün içindeki .asm uzantılı dosyalarda örnek kodların main kısmı.
Sorularınıza hızlı cevap alın: http://www.picproje.org/index.php/topic,57135.0.html

OptimusPrime

Ucuz etin yahnisi yenmez  :D Bu cipin maliyeti, yazilim gelistirmeyide icine koyarsak kuvvetle ihtimal @RaMu nun bahsettigi microchip serisinden daha pahaliya gelecektir.  :(

Neyse yerinde olsam cipin ureticisi veya Turkiye deki dagiticisi ile iletisime gecerdim.  ::ok
https://donanimveyazilim.wordpress.com || Cihân-ârâ cihân içredir ârâyı bilmezler, O mâhîler ki deryâ içredir deryâyı bilmezler ||

merve damar

Teşekkürler. Şuan örnek kodlar üzerinde çalışıyoruz. Kodları çalıştırmaya çalışıyoruz. Paylaştıklarınızı inceleyeceğim teşekkürler.

merve damar

http://read.pudn.com/downloads416/sourcecode/asm/1767214/C%20%E8%AF%AD%E8%A8%80%E8%B0%83%E7%94%A8LIB/Touch/Touch.c__.htm
Burdaki Kodu çalıştırmaya çalışıyoruz. Fakat 24üncü satırda hata veriyor. Bu satırdaki kodun ne anlama geldiğini biliyor musunuz?

bulut_01

24ci satırı sildiğinizde normal derliyor mu?
YENİLMEZ..

RaMu

//#include "BS83B08-3.h"
yorumu kaldır, muhtemelen "_wctl" o dosyada tanımlıdır,
program derlenirken "_wctl" tanımlı değil diye hata veriyordur şuan.
Sorularınıza hızlı cevap alın: http://www.picproje.org/index.php/topic,57135.0.html

merve damar

Alıntı yapılan: bulut_01 - 22 Ağustos 2019, 10:30:5524ci satırı sildiğinizde normal derliyor mu?
Hayır başka hatalarla karşılaşıyoruz. Üstte paylaştığım ana fonksiyon ve bunun dışında kütüphaneler var. Hatalar bu kütüphanelere bağlı olarak çıkıyor. Bence 2 farklı dil kullandığı için karışıklık olmuş. Kütüphanelerde asm olarak yazıyor, ana fonksiyonda c diinde çağırıyor. Ve haliyle derleyici bunu tanımıyor.